【求助帖】全是re,用的桶排序,不用扫,为什么也过不了啊?
查看原帖
【求助帖】全是re,用的桶排序,不用扫,为什么也过不了啊?
429707
阿四与你楼主2021/5/27 20:10
#include<stdio.h>
int book[1000010];
int main()
{
	int n,m,x;
	scanf("%d %d",&n,&m);
	for(int i=1;i<=n;i++)
	{
		scanf("%d",&x);//[0]列存储数值,[1]存储i的位置 
		if(book[x]==0) book[x]=i;
	}
	for(int i=1;i<=m;i++)
	{
		scanf("%d",&x);
		if(book[x]==0) printf("-1");
		else printf("%d ",book[x]);
	}
	//getchar();getchar();
	return 0;
}
2021/5/27 20:10
加载中...